#include "L10nLoader.hpp"
 | 
						|
 | 
						|
#include <vector>
 | 
						|
#include <memory>
 | 
						|
 | 
						|
#include <QApplication>
 | 
						|
#include <QLocale>
 | 
						|
#include <QTranslator>
 | 
						|
#include <QRegularExpression>
 | 
						|
#include <QDebug>
 | 
						|
 | 
						|
#include "qt_helpers.hpp"
 | 
						|
#include "Logger.hpp"
 | 
						|
 | 
						|
#include "pimpl_impl.hpp"
 | 
						|
 | 
						|
class L10nLoader::impl final
 | 
						|
{
 | 
						|
public:
 | 
						|
  explicit impl(QApplication * app)
 | 
						|
    : app_ {app}
 | 
						|
  {
 | 
						|
  }
 | 
						|
 | 
						|
  bool load_translator (QString const& filename
 | 
						|
                        , QString const& directory = QString {}
 | 
						|
                        , QString const& search_delimiters = QString {}
 | 
						|
                        , QString const& suffix = QString {})
 | 
						|
  {
 | 
						|
    std::unique_ptr<QTranslator> translator {new QTranslator};
 | 
						|
    if (translator->load (filename, directory, search_delimiters, suffix))
 | 
						|
      {
 | 
						|
        install (std::move (translator));
 | 
						|
        return true;
 | 
						|
      }
 | 
						|
    return false;
 | 
						|
  }
 | 
						|
 | 
						|
  bool load_translator (QLocale const& locale, QString const& filename
 | 
						|
                        , QString const& prefix = QString {}
 | 
						|
                        , QString const& directory = QString {}
 | 
						|
                        , QString const& suffix = QString {})
 | 
						|
  {
 | 
						|
    std::unique_ptr<QTranslator> translator {new QTranslator};
 | 
						|
    if (translator->load (locale, filename, prefix, directory, suffix))
 | 
						|
      {
 | 
						|
        install (std::move (translator));
 | 
						|
        return true;
 | 
						|
      }
 | 
						|
    return false;
 | 
						|
  }
 | 
						|
 | 
						|
  void install (std::unique_ptr<QTranslator> translator)
 | 
						|
  {
 | 
						|
    app_->installTranslator (translator.get ());
 | 
						|
    translators_.push_back (std::move (translator));
 | 
						|
  }
 | 
						|
  
 | 
						|
  QApplication * app_;
 | 
						|
  std::vector<std::unique_ptr<QTranslator>> translators_;
 | 
						|
};
 | 
						|
 | 
						|
L10nLoader::L10nLoader (QApplication * app, QLocale const& locale, QString const& language_override)
 | 
						|
  : m_ {app}
 | 
						|
{
 | 
						|
  LOG_INFO (QString {"locale: language: %1 script: %2 country: %3 ui-languages: %4"}
 | 
						|
     .arg (QLocale::languageToString (locale.language ()))
 | 
						|
     .arg (QLocale::scriptToString (locale.script ()))
 | 
						|
     .arg (QLocale::countryToString (locale.country ()))
 | 
						|
     .arg (locale.uiLanguages ().join (", ")));
 | 
						|
 | 
						|
  // we  don't load  translators  if the  language  override is  'en',
 | 
						|
  // 'en_US', or 'en-US'. In these cases  we assume the user is trying
 | 
						|
  // to disable translations loaded because of their locale. We cannot
 | 
						|
  // load any locale based translations in this case.
 | 
						|
  auto skip_locale = language_override.contains (QRegularExpression {"^(?:en|en[-_]US)$"});
 | 
						|
 | 
						|
  //
 | 
						|
  // Enable base i18n
 | 
						|
  //
 | 
						|
  QString translations_dir {":/Translations"};
 | 
						|
  if (!skip_locale)
 | 
						|
    {
 | 
						|
      LOG_TRACE ("Looking for locale based Qt translations in resources filesystem");
 | 
						|
      if (m_->load_translator (locale, "qt", "_", translations_dir))
 | 
						|
        {
 | 
						|
          LOG_INFO ("Loaded Qt translations for current locale from resources");
 | 
						|
        }
 | 
						|
 | 
						|
      // Default translations for releases  use translations stored in
 | 
						|
      // the   resources   file    system   under   the   Translations
 | 
						|
      // directory. These are built by the CMake build system from .ts
 | 
						|
      // files in the translations source directory. New languages are
 | 
						|
      // added by  enabling the  UPDATE_TRANSLATIONS CMake  option and
 | 
						|
      // building with the  new language added to  the LANGUAGES CMake
 | 
						|
      // list  variable.  UPDATE_TRANSLATIONS  will preserve  existing
 | 
						|
      // translations  but   should  only  be  set   when  adding  new
 | 
						|
      // languages.  The  resulting .ts  files should be  checked info
 | 
						|
      // source control for translators to access and update.
 | 
						|
 | 
						|
      // try and load the base translation
 | 
						|
      LOG_TRACE ("Looking for WSJT-X translations based on UI languages in the resources filesystem");
 | 
						|
      for (QString locale_name : locale.uiLanguages ())
 | 
						|
        {
 | 
						|
          auto language = locale_name.left (2);
 | 
						|
          if (locale.uiLanguages ().front ().left (2) == language)
 | 
						|
            {
 | 
						|
              LOG_TRACE (QString {"Trying %1"}.arg (language));
 | 
						|
              if (m_->load_translator ("wsjtx_" + language, translations_dir))
 | 
						|
                {
 | 
						|
                  LOG_INFO (QString {"Loaded WSJT-X base translation file from %1 based on language %2"}
 | 
						|
                     .arg (translations_dir)
 | 
						|
                     .arg (language));
 | 
						|
                  break;
 | 
						|
                }
 | 
						|
            }
 | 
						|
        }
 | 
						|
      // now try and load the most specific translations (may be a
 | 
						|
      // duplicate but we shouldn't care)
 | 
						|
      LOG_TRACE ("Looking for WSJT-X translations based on locale in the resources filesystem");
 | 
						|
      if (m_->load_translator (locale, "wsjtx", "_", translations_dir))
 | 
						|
        {
 | 
						|
          LOG_INFO ("Loaded WSJT-X translations for current locale from resources");
 | 
						|
        }
 | 
						|
    }
 | 
						|
  
 | 
						|
  // Load  any matching  translation  from  the current  directory
 | 
						|
  // using the command line  option language override. This allows
 | 
						|
  // translators to  easily test  their translations  by releasing
 | 
						|
  // (lrelease)  a .qm  file  into the  current  directory with  a
 | 
						|
  // suitable name  (e.g.  wsjtx_en_GB.qm), then running  wsjtx to
 | 
						|
  // view the  results.
 | 
						|
  if (language_override.size ())
 | 
						|
    {
 | 
						|
      auto language = language_override;
 | 
						|
      language.replace ('-', '_');
 | 
						|
      // try and load the base translation
 | 
						|
      auto base_language = language.left (2);
 | 
						|
      LOG_TRACE ("Looking for WSJT-X translations based on command line region override in the resources filesystem");
 | 
						|
      if (m_->load_translator ("wsjtx_" + base_language, translations_dir))
 | 
						|
        {
 | 
						|
          LOG_INFO (QString {"Loaded base translation file from %1 based on language %2"}
 | 
						|
             .arg (translations_dir)
 | 
						|
             .arg (base_language));
 | 
						|
        }
 | 
						|
      // now load the requested translations (may be a duplicate
 | 
						|
      // but we shouldn't care)
 | 
						|
      LOG_TRACE ("Looking for WSJT-X translations based on command line override country in the resources filesystem");
 | 
						|
      if (m_->load_translator ("wsjtx_" + language, translations_dir))
 | 
						|
        {
 | 
						|
          LOG_INFO (QString {"Loaded translation file from %1 based on language %2"}
 | 
						|
              .arg (translations_dir)
 | 
						|
             .arg (language));
 | 
						|
        }
 | 
						|
    }
 | 
						|
 | 
						|
  // Load any  matching translation  from the current  directory using
 | 
						|
  // the current locale. This allows  translators to easily test their
 | 
						|
  // translations by releasing (lrelease) a  .qm file into the current
 | 
						|
  // directory  with  a  suitable name  (e.g.   wsjtx_en_GB.qm),  then
 | 
						|
  // running wsjtx to view the results. The system locale setting will
 | 
						|
  // be used to select the translation file which can be overridden by
 | 
						|
  // the LANG environment variable on non-Windows system.
 | 
						|
 | 
						|
  // try and load the base translation
 | 
						|
  LOG_TRACE ("Looking for WSJT-X translations based on command line override country in the current directory");
 | 
						|
  for (QString locale_name : locale.uiLanguages ())
 | 
						|
    {
 | 
						|
      auto language = locale_name.left (2);
 | 
						|
      if (locale.uiLanguages ().front ().left (2) == language)
 | 
						|
        {
 | 
						|
          LOG_TRACE (QString {"Trying %1"}.arg (language));
 | 
						|
          if (m_->load_translator ("wsjtx_" + language))
 | 
						|
            {
 | 
						|
              LOG_INFO (QString {"Loaded base translation file from $cwd based on language %1"}.arg (language));
 | 
						|
              break;
 | 
						|
            }
 | 
						|
        }
 | 
						|
    }
 | 
						|
 | 
						|
  if (!skip_locale)
 | 
						|
    {
 | 
						|
      // now try  and load  the most specific  translations (may  be a
 | 
						|
      // duplicate but we shouldn't care)
 | 
						|
      LOG_TRACE ("Looking for WSJT-X translations based on locale in the resources filesystem");
 | 
						|
      if (m_->load_translator (locale, "wsjtx", "_"))
 | 
						|
        {
 | 
						|
          LOG_INFO ("loaded translations for current locale from a file");
 | 
						|
        }
 | 
						|
    }
 | 
						|
 | 
						|
  // Load any  matching translation  from the current  directory using
 | 
						|
  // the   command  line   option  language   override.  This   allows
 | 
						|
  // translators  to  easily test  their  translations  on Windows  by
 | 
						|
  // releasing (lrelease) a .qm file into the current directory with a
 | 
						|
  // suitable name (e.g.  wsjtx_en_GB.qm),  then running wsjtx to view
 | 
						|
  // the results.
 | 
						|
  if (language_override.size ())
 | 
						|
    {
 | 
						|
      auto language = language_override;
 | 
						|
      language.replace ('-', '_');
 | 
						|
      // try and load the base translation
 | 
						|
      auto base_language = language.left (2);
 | 
						|
      LOG_TRACE ("Looking for WSJT-X translations based on command line override country in the current directory");
 | 
						|
      if (m_->load_translator ("wsjtx_" + base_language))
 | 
						|
        {
 | 
						|
          LOG_INFO (QString {"Loaded base translation file from $cwd based on language %1"}.arg (base_language));
 | 
						|
        }
 | 
						|
      // now load the requested translations (may be a duplicate
 | 
						|
      // but we shouldn't care)
 | 
						|
      LOG_TRACE ("Looking for WSJT-X translations based on command line region in the current directory");
 | 
						|
      if (m_->load_translator ("wsjtx_" + language))
 | 
						|
        {
 | 
						|
          LOG_INFO (QString {"loaded translation file from $cwd based on language %1"}.arg (language));
 | 
						|
        }
 | 
						|
    }
 | 
						|
}
 | 
						|
 | 
						|
L10nLoader::~L10nLoader ()
 | 
						|
{
 | 
						|
}
